VIRGINIA METAL PROD. CORP. v. HARTFORD ACC. & IND. CO.

No. 93, Docket 23113.

219 F.2d 931 (1955)

VIRGINIA METAL PRODUCTS CORPORATION, Appellant, v. HARTFORD ACCIDENT AND INDEMNITY COMPANY, Appellee.

United States Court of Appeals, Second Circuit.

Decided February 14, 1955.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Fennelly, Eagan, Nager & Lage, Morris Gutt, New York City, James L. O'Connor, New York City, for appellant.

Kissam & Halpin, Leo T. Kissam, New York City, for appellee, James H. Halpin, Eric Nightingale, New York City, of counsel.

Before L. HAND, MEDINA and DIMOCK, Circuit Judges.


L. HAND, Circuit Judge.

This is an appeal from a judgment, summarily dismissing a complaint upon a policy, insuring the plaintiff against losses through fraudulent or dishonest acts of its employees, which the complaint alleged that the plaintiff had suffered through the conduct of its treasurer, one Taylor.
